How do I turn off autocorrect in Mail?

In Mail, I would like to turn off autocorrect, which makes me say many ridiculous things! How do I do that? I've looked and looked and can't figure it out. Thanks!

It sounds like you are wanting to turn off the spelling correction feature in the Mail application. You should be able to do that with these steps from the following article:


OS X Yosemite: Check spelling and grammar

For a specific app: In the app, choose Edit > Spelling and Grammar > Correct Spelling Automatically (it’s off when a checkmark isn’t shown).


For all apps: Choose Apple menu > System Preferences, click Keyboard, click Text, then deselect the “Correct spelling automatically” checkbox.
